It was a cold, dreary day. Rin walked through the streets of town, scuffing his shoes on the pavement as he went, occasionally kicking a rock along. If only he had actually paid attention to the news that morning before going out, or even looked up at the dark clouds above. Yukio was gonna kill him when he got back; he always found something to nitpick about. Rin kept staring at his shoes as he went, lost in thought about how he would explain this to his brother.

Suddenly, Rin thought he heard his name being called. He paid no attention to it at first, he figured it was someone else with a similar name. But…that voice sounded familiar…

Rin was always good at telling people’s voices apart, and that ability was only amplified when he became aware of his demonic powers. That voice he had heard sounded gruff, and yet something was different. Comforting, in a way.

Rin looked up when he heard his name again, closer this time. He knew that voice, he had heard it every day in class since he had started at the cram school.

“Suguro?” Rin asked, confused. He watched the familiar form of his classmate approach him. Rin hadn’t noticed, but he had stopped in the middle of the sidewalk.

The rain started coming down harder. Rin reached into his bag, careful not to expose his papers to the elements, and pulled out the hair clip Bon had given him so long ago. He pulled his hair out of his eyes and pinned it back, just before Suguro arrived.

“Hey, dumbass, didn’t you see it was gonna rain? God, it’s like I’m always the one that ends up havin’ ta look after ya, Okumura,” Ryūji grumbled. Without looking up, he shoved the umbrella in Rin’s direction.

Rin grinned. “I didn’t notice! Thanks, Bon. You can be a real softie sometimes, you know that? You’re always so serious, it’s nice to see you lighten up once in a while!” He easily dodged the light punch to the arm.

“Don’t call me Bon! Anyways, I was just passin’ through, it’s not like I was keepin’ track of you or anything…” Ryūji turned his face away, blood rushing up to his face. Rin, of course, was oblivious to this and walked happily along with him.

“What were you doin’ in town, anyways?” Bon eventually asked, trying to hide his curiosity.

“Ah, that! I was just getting some ingredients for Ukobach, he said we were running short on some things. What about you?”

“N-nothing,” Suguro said, avoiding Rin’s question. The truth was, he had been out jogging and it looked like nobody was at the dorm Yukio and Rin were staying at, so he wanted to make sure Rin was doing alright. He didn’t know why, but he cared about Rin.

Rin cast a glance over at Ryūji. His gaze was locked in place on the ground ahead of them, not daring to look up. Rin thought he looked kinda cute like that.

They walked in silence as they approached the True Cross Academy campus. Finally, Rin spoke.

“Well, um, since we’re here I guess I’d better go to my dorm,” he said nervously. Why did the thought of leaving Bon make him so unhappy? Rin figured it was probably just because he didn’t want to get rained on even more. He started to move out from under the umbrella when Bon grabbed his wrist.

“Nuh-uh, I’m gonna take you to your dorm. And don’t even think about protesting, it’s still pourin’ out. You might catch a cold,” Suguro told him firmly. They looked into each other’s eyes for a brief moment, then Bon realized he was still holding onto Rin. He let go and kept walking, fighting the huge blush trying to make its way to the surface of his face. Rin felt warm, like a fire on a cold winter day. Ryūji distanced himself as best as possible while still staying under the umbrella, which is to say hardly at all. God, Rin made him feel so nervous. He hoped the halfling didn’t notice his heart beating out of his chest.

Rin walked along in silence, too absorbed in his own thoughts to notice how Bon was acting at the moment. Bon had grabbed his wrist…why did that make his heart race? He felt like he was on the verge of combustion and fought to keep his flames in check. For some reason that he couldn’t explain, he wanted to stay close to Bon. Rin stepped a tiny bit closer.

Suguro didn’t outwardly react when he felt Rin bump up against his arm, but inside he was panicking. Ryūji could usually stay calm and keep his composure without problem, but it all went out the window when Rin was involved. Shit, why did Rin keep getting closer? And why was he grinning like a total dork? Okay, so I think the fangs are badass, Bon thought to himself as he looked at Rin’s smile. And maybe his ears are kinda cute, and he’s a dumbass in the adorably lovable way. That doesn’t mean I like him!

Still, Bon could not deny the way Rin’s presence felt right to him, how he always lit up a room (literally and figuratively). Okay, so maybe I have a little, tiny, miniscule crush on the guy. Anyways, he probably doesn’t like me back, he clearly has a crush on Moriyama-san, Bon reasoned. For now, he would be content just being friends with him.

Rin struggled with his own dilemma. He had gotten crushes on a couple of guys before, and he certainly admired Shiemi, but nothing compared to how he felt about Ryūji. Sure, Bon was intimidating at first, but Rin liked that about him. He was levelheaded and incredibly loyal, and he was always there to watch out for Rin. When Yukio protected Rin, it was frustrating. Suguro, however, never made Rin feel like he was trapped, like a bird in a cage. With Bon, Rin felt free. He—

Okumura!” Startled back to reality, Rin realized they had stopped walking.

“Sorry, must’ve zoned out! What were you saying?” Rin said with an awkward laugh.

“I asked you if ya wanted to wear my jacket. You’re shiverin’!”

“Ah, sure,” Rin said gratefully, now aware of the wind against his soaked clothes. Friends shared jackets, right? As Bon handed the umbrella to Rin, their hands brushed against each other and it felt like electricity shooting up Rin’s arm. He had never noticed how toned Bon’s biceps were, probably from all the workouts. Rin put the jacket on and took in the scent of it. It smelled just like Bon. Wait, why do I know what Bon smells like?!

“T-thanks Bon!” Rin stammered as his brain short-circuited. The butterflies in his stomach couldn’t be ignored anymore, he definitely had a thing for his friend.

“Whatever, it’s nothin’,” Ryūji muttered. “Let’s just hurry up.”

Rin was also pretty good at telling emotions, especially when he knew the person. Their scent changed slightly depending on what they were feeling, and Bon smelled nervous. This was a fairly uncommon one, the only other times he ever smelled like that was when they were up against a higher ranking demon. Unless…?

Rin decided to experiment. He bumped his hand against Suguro’s, hoping not to get a negative reaction. To his surprise, Ryūji’s hand caught Rin’s before he could pull away. They walked like this for a while, hand in hand, neither one of them daring to reposition in case the other let go.

They were at the dorm. It had seemed like only moments ago that they were entering the campus, and neither Ryūji nor Rin wanted to leave.

“I, uh, guess I should head in,” Rin started. It was clear he was disappointed about it. He started to turn away.

Bon made a split second decision. “Rin, wait!” He grabbed him by both arms and turned him around. “Okumura…I think I like you.” Maybe his feelings wouldn’t be reciprocated, but he had to try. The hand holding had to count for something, right? Besides, Bon wasn’t sure when he would have another opportunity for this.

“Oh! I mean, we’re friends so you don’t have to tell me!” Rin said, missing the point entirely.

“No, dumbass, I like you. As in, romantically. I totally get it if you don’t feel the same, I just…I needed to get that out in the open.” Bon looked at the ground, refusing to meet Rin’s eyes. Maybe this wasn’t such a great idea after all, he thought to himself.

Rin reached up and lifted Ryūji’s chin. “Look at me,” he said. “I like you too. So, if you want to, we can try things out, see where they go.” He smiled. “Ryūji, will you be my boyfriend?”

In answer, Bon held Rin’s face in both hands and kissed him. The two of them stood in the rain, no longer caring if they got wet, the umbrella completely forgotten. All that mattered was each other in that moment, and it was perfect.
